Meeke celebrates Curitiba triumph

Kris Meeke celebrated his second successive victory on Rally Internacional de Curitiba with by taking to the city’s race circuit in his Peugeot 207 Super 2000.



The Intercontinental Rally Challenge counter was based at the track, which will host the opening two rounds of the World Touring Car Championship today (Sunday). The races are being televised live on Eurosport.

After completing his lap of the circuit and performing a series of donuts for the crowd, Meeke credited his win to Peugeot UK, which is supporting his IRC title campaign with Kronos Racing.

“Peugeot UK have been absolutely incredible and I think their commitment also got Škoda UK interested in supporting a car for Guy Wilks this year,” said Meeke. “To have two UK importers finishing first and second ahead of the factory cars is very good for everyone and shows the benefit importers can get from doing the IRC.”
